Default Type VIIB - WTH is wrong???

OK guys, I'm completely stumped.

This is the 2nd time I'm trying the VIIB out during my career, and it seems to be a real pig. The specs - those that I've seen at any rate - say the boat should do 17-18kts surfaced and 8kts submerged, yet all I'm seeing here is 14kts / 4kts(!!!!!) tops. WTH is wrong?

And the engine telegraph / speed dial seems to be broken too. When I ask for, say, 10kts forward the boat accelerates to 5-6kts and stays there. Again, WTH?

And it can't be the weather either, BTW. I had dead calm seas both times.

Any ideas guys? Or have I grossly misunderstood something here? Am I really doomed to end my career in a IIA - as much as I do love that little boat - or perhaps earn more renown and upgrade to something else altogether later?
